What Does a Will Deliver?

A professionally drafted Will allows you to:

  • Appoint executors to implement your wishes
  • Assign guardians for minor children
  • Express your funeral preferences
  • Allocate gifts or legacies
  • Designate beneficiaries across your estate

"Life Moments" That Prompt Wills

Clients often come to us when:

  • Buying a home
  • Marrying or remarrying
  • Starting or growing a family
  • Receiving inheritance or gifts
  • Planning abroad travel
  • Facing health changes or surgery
  • Experiencing grief or family changes
  • Adjusting relationship dynamics
